The clinical navigation system MATRIX POLAR enables a quick calibration within seconds and the navigation of shaver and suction tubes and further surgical instruments by Bien Air. This is ensued with the help of the Instrument Adapter System.
Conventional surgical instruments, such as suction tubes or active surgical instruments - as for example shavers and drills from Bien Air - may be freely chosen for navigation by the surgeon.
Furthermore, disturbing interruptions during operations are omitted. By using the navigation of surgical instruments no instrument's change in order to obtain navigational data is needed.
Finally, the safety during surgery is increased as navigational data is continously provided by active surgical instruments.
